About This Book

Crunch! Can you hear the snap of teeth chomping down? Imagine if your teeth grew so long they poked out even when your mouth was closed—what kind of animal would you be? Discover surprising secrets about your teeth and how they compare to those of creatures big and small, past and present.

Quick Assessment

This engaging picture book introduces early readers to the fascinating world of teeth through a fun comparison between human and animal anatomy. Suitable for ages 5-8, it combines educational content with entertaining illustrations to spark curiosity about biology and evolution. There is no intense content, making it appropriate for young children interested in nature and science.
